Uterine artery pseudoaneurysm : A case of late intraabdominal haemorrhage after caesarean section

Uterine artery pseudoaneurysm (UAP) is a rare acquired vascular malformation associated with vaginal bleeding or intraabdominal haemorrhage occurring after pelvic surgery.
